I purchased this amp at a recent guitar show and was pleasantly surprised when I got it home, finding that it is 100% original. While I don't recommend using it as such, it is my prerogative to list it as-is. I can change out the filter caps and the grounded power cable for the buyer, if desired.
A group of vintage tubes are in the amp and all tested out except for one of the power tubes that were in the amp when it arrived. I changed the power tubes for a tested set of US made tubes.
The original transformers date to late 1963 and early '64. The original speaker, a Jensen C12R, dates to early '64. The tube chart stamp "NE" dates the amp to May, 1964.
The amp is stunningly clean. It operates just fine, but it is clear that the electrolytic caps need to be changed.
